Default 200NL Middle set on flush board

Villain is 23/16/1.7. Seems Taggish.

Party Poker No-Limit Hold'em, $ BB (6 handed) Hand History Converter Tool from FlopTurnRiver.com (Format: 2+2 Forums)

BB ($282.85)
UTG ($222.28)
MP ($271.80)
CO ($81.87)
Hero ($258.90)
SB ($198)

Preflop: Hero is Button with J[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img], J[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img]. SB posts a blind of $1.
<font color="#666666">1 fold</font>, <font color="#CC3333">MP raises to $8</font>, CO calls $8, Hero calls $8, <font color="#666666">2 folds</font>.

Flop: ($27) J[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img], Q[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img], 6[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(3 players)</font>
MP checks, CO checks, <font color="#CC3333">Hero bets $16</font>, <font color="#CC3333">MP raises to $32</font>, CO folds, Hero calls $16.

Turn: ($91) 7[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(2 players)</font>
MP checks, <font color="#CC3333">Hero bets $50</font>, MP calls $50.

River: ($191) 2[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(2 players)</font>
MP checks, Hero bets $180.00 (All-In)

No thoughts on this. After flop action I decided he was on QQ and nothing else.

By river I was sure he wasn't on the flush, still thought he probably had QQ scared of the flush. I nearly checked behind but at the last minute I decided, heck it, I'm seeing monsters under the bed, I can't be afraid of only one combo, maybe he has AQ,QJ, puuuuuush. (Should of probably bet smaller on river against those hands, but I had nearly timed out by the time I decided to bet.)

bet 66 on the turn - I'm torn on the river though

it seems like a value bet cause K[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img]K and A[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img]A will call, and maybe stuff like A[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img]Q - but I dunno if it's enough to make the bet +EV

I mean, I push this every single time, but I dunno if it's good poker

Bet more on the flop. Call flop is fine.
Turn is fine.
Do not go allin on the river, you will be called only by flushes, QQ and 66. Half the pot.
I will also made it 3bet preflop, but call is fine too.

I doubt he's checking a made flush twice. You have to bet more on the turn to build that pot and make a bet on the river easier to call. The allin makes it look like you're repping the flush too hard after the turn bet.
